13th Annual Juried Studio Artists' Exhibition

Reading, PA – GoggleWorks Center for the Arts (GoggleWorks) presents the 13th Annual GoggleWorks Juried Studio Artists’ Exhibition in the Irvin & Louis E. Cohen Gallery from October 28 through January 7, 2018. An opening reception will take place on November 3rd from 5:30-7:30pm during GoggleWorks’ free monthly event, Spotlight Night.

“Selected by the exhibition committee, GoggleWorks’ Juried Studio Artists range from emerging to established professionals with national reputations. They work in a variety of mediums in studios provided on the 2nd and 3rd floor of GoggleWorks’ main building. More than just a work space, GoggleWorks’ Juried Studios fosters growth by providing studio artists will a community of professionals in the field willing to engage critically with each other. These artists regularly collaborate within the building and are engaged with the community beyond our walls,” says Lauralynn White, Gallery Director.

The annual exhibition includes watercolor, oil, acrylic, photography, ceramics, sculpture, and multi-media pieces created within the past year by the following artists and alum:

Other exhibitions opening on the evening of November 3rd include The Cup., juried by ceramic artist Kurt Anderson, which features functional drinking vessels from all over the country and will be displayed in the lobby, outside of The Store. Kurt Anderson will present an artist talk in the Boscov Film Theatre at 5:30pm. He will lead a visiting artist workshop, Fauxk: Unique and Inventive Surfaces on November 4-5th.

Reading Skatepark Association presents the RSA Community Art Show in the Cafe Space.

Local photographer Blair Sietz will present One Camera, Seven Lives in the Schmidt Gallery on the second floor.
